WebFeb 4, 2024 · Moderate to severe traumatic brain injury can result in prolonged or permanent changes in a person's state of consciousness, awareness or responsiveness. Different states of consciousness include: Coma. A person in a coma is unconscious, unaware of anything and unable to respond to any stimulus. WebSep 8, 2024 · TBI Symptoms. Moderate to severe TBIs are more serious injuries than concussions. They can be caused by a severe blow to the head or a penetrating injury, like a bone from a fractured skull or a bullet. An open TBI refers to an injury where the skull is damaged and there is an opening in the bone. can flowbee be used on long hair

WebJun 2, 2024 · Trauma or injury to this part of the brain can cause personality and behavior changes. It can cause attention problems, language difficulty, impulsive behavior, and inappropriate social behavior. Frontal lobe trauma may require surgery if there’s bleeding or any foreign objects in the brain.
